However, to learn, you need to develop a general troubleshooting approach - a logical, methodical, method of narrowing down the problem. A tech tip database might suggest: 'Replace C536' for a particular symptom. This is good advice for a specific problem on one model. However, what you really want to understand is why C536 was the cause and how to pinpoint the culprit in general even if you don't have a service manual or schematic and your tech tip database doesn't have an entry for your sick TV or VCR.

While schematics are nice, you won't always have them or be able to justify the purchase for a one-of repair. Therefore, in many cases, some reverse engineering will be necessary. The time will be well spent since even if you don't see another instance of the same model in your entire lifetime, you will have learned something in the process that can be applied to other equipment problems.
As always, when you get stuck, checking out a tech-tips database may quickly identify your problem and solution.In that case, you can greatly simplify your troubleshooting or at least confirm a diagnosis before ordering parts.

REPAIRING / SERVICING TV THOMSON T32E02U-01B

Technical description and composition of the THOMSON T32E02U-01B TV, panel type and modules used. The composition of the modules.
THOMSON LED
Model: T32E02U-01B
Chassis / Version: 3MS82AX
Panel: A320HE2A05-7A
LED driver (backlight): integrated into MainBoard
PWM LED driver: OB3363QPA
Power Supply (PSU): integrated into MainBoard
PWM Power: PWM SOT23-6
MainBoard: TP.MS18VG.P78 3MS82AX
IC MainBoard: CPU: MST3M182VGC-LF -Z1, Spi Flash: 25Q32, EEPROM: 24C32, AUDIO: TPA3110LD2
Tuner: R620D

General recommendations for TV LCD LED repair
Possible manifestations of malfunctions
- THOMSON T32E02U-01B does not turn on and does not show any signs of operability at all. Does not blink indicators and does not respond to control buttons.
In such cases, the main power supply, the AC / DC converter of the mains voltage, which is combined with the MainBoard TP.MS18VG.P78, may be faulty. Its output voltages should be measured, and if they are absent, check the serviceability of the power switches of the converters and rectifier diodes for the probability of a short circuit.
In case of any breakdown of semiconductors in the secondary circuits, the converter can usually operate normally in an emergency short-circuit mode. There are no output voltages. And with a short circuit in the power elements of the primary circuit, as a rule, the mains fuse breaks and, less often, the current sensor in the source of the key.
Mos-Fet keys used in switching power supplies usually fail due to a malfunction of other elements, which can disable it in key mode, or provoke an excess of the maximum current or voltage values. These can be circuits supplying the PWM controller, damper or frequency setting circuits, or OOS (negative feedback) elements in the stabilization circuit. PWM controllers (PWM) PWM SOT23-6, in the absence of external damage and a short circuit between the terminals, are checked by replacing them with a known good one.
- There is no image, there is sound, it reacts to the remote control, the channels are switched. In some cases, the image appears when turned on and disappears immediately.
A malfunction is usually in these cases most likely in the backlight units of the display matrix. The reason may be both in the power supply of the LEDs, in their serviceability (breakdown or breakage), as well as in the violation of the contact connections of the LED strips.
To identify an open circuit in the LED lines without disassembling the panel, a current source is required. It is impossible to open the junctions connected in series with a simple multimeter; a voltage of several tens of volts is required.
- The TV does not go into operation, does not respond to the remote control. The indicator on the front panel is on or blinking.

 If THOMSON T49D21SF-01B has no picture, but there is sound, often the display backlight simply does not work. Moreover, in LED TVs, the LEDs inside the panel usually fail, less often the LED driver.
In such cases, you can see a barely noticeable image with a successful hit of external light on the screen.
Replacing the LEDs requires disassembling the LCD panel - a process that requires experience and qualifications from the master. We do not recommend doing such work on your own to the owners of TVs and craftsmen who do not have experience in repairing LCD panels
If there is no image, and the backlight is on, the screen becomes slightly lighter when turned on, and in an open TV you can see light through the holes in the panel case.
In this case, the panel may also be faulty - damage to the strips, loops, for example, as a result of moisture ingress after unsuccessful washing of the screen, the T-CON (Timing Controller) board may be faulty. But often the main board MainBoard turns out to be faulty, a software failure is also possible.
Then, first of all, it is necessary to check the panel supply voltage, fuses on the T-CON board, as well as the supply and reference voltages of the column and line drivers - VGH, VGL, Vcom.
If these measurements are within normal limits, it is necessary to trace the passage of LVDS signals from the MainBoard with an oscilloscope, as well as synchronization signals to the loops with drivers.
Flooded or unsuccessfully washed screens of LED TVs can be restored, in about half of the cases, usually if significant damage has not formed in the loops and panel strips.


Repair or diagnostics of the TP.MS18VG.P78 motherboard should begin with checking the stabilizers and power converters necessary to power the microcircuits and matrix. If necessary, you should update or replace the software (software). In some cases, to repair the MB (SSB) board, it may be necessary to replace the chips - CPU: MST3M182VGC-LF -Z1, Spi Flash: 25Q32, EEPROM: 24C32, AUDIO: TPA3110LD2 with new or known working ones. In cases where BGA technologies are used, defects are usually localized by heating.
If the TV operates normally from external devices, but does not tune to TV channels, the R620D tuner may be defective. In such cases, first of all, you should make sure that there are supply voltages at its corresponding terminals. It is also necessary to make sure that the tuner and processor can exchange data via the I2C bus. Sometimes the reason for the inoperability of the tuner may be a software failure.

To reduce the backlight current in LED drivers with OB3363QP (16 pin) controller, the total resistance of the resistors from pin 5 (ISET) to the case should be proportionally increased.

The main features of the THOMSON T32E02U-01B device:
Installed matrix (LED-panel) A320HE2A05-7A.
To power the backlight LEDs, a converter combined with the main board TP.MS18VG.P78 is used, controlled by the OB3363QPA PWM controller.
The power module is combined with the MainBoard and is made according to the AC / DC flyback voltage converter using PWM SOT23-6 microcircuits.
MainBoard - the main board (motherboard) is a TP.MS18VG.P78 module, using CPU chips: MST3M182VGC-LF -Z1, Spi Flash: 25Q32, EEPROM: 24C32, AUDIO: TPA3110LD2 and others.
The R620D tuner provides reception of television programs and tuning to channels.
